Our Unit Helpers support the mission of McHarrie life by:
Providing support to the nursing staff and residents as requested, which could include:
o Call lights and unit phones as directed.
o Pass fresh water pitchers to residents.
o Turn down/make beds as needed.
o Pass trays to those residents that do not need feeding assistance.
o Transport residents to/from activities and supper.
o Pass snacks to those residents that do not need feeding assistance.
o Pick up meal trays.
o Tidy clean/dirty utility rooms, nourishment station and nurse’s station.
o Document consumption as necessary.
o 1:1 companionship with residents as directed by the supervisor
Unit Helpers DO NOT provide direct contact care with the residents.
Required qualities for successful Unit Helpers:
- Must be 16 years of age and have a desire/interest in working with the elderly.
- Must be able to function independently.
- Good interpersonal and effective communication skills to relate with residents, family members, staff, and supervisors.
- Flexible and receptive to change.
